Our mission is to provide families and individuals with items they have lost due to fire, loss of home, lack of renter’s/homeowner’s insurance, domestic situations, etc. We also work in conjunction with other outreach programs in the area.

Our founder, Bobbi and our team of Volunteers are a force to be reckoned with. We are very active in our community. Our clients are usually referred to us by other agencies.
